As demand for weight-loss drugs rises, states grapple with Medicaid coverage In January, the National Association of Medicaid Directors told the federal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services that state Medicaid departments had significant concerns over the fiscal impacts of the Biden proposal to require coverage of GLP-1s, and strongly recommend that CMS maintain the current state option to cover or not cover anti-obesity medications. But others say covering the drugs will yield long-term savings

A new target trial emulation analyzed insurance claims data from over 3,500 pregnancies and found that continuation of GLP-1 RAs during the first trimester of pregnancy was not associated with a substantially increased risk for pregnancy loss, abnormal fetal growth, or major birth defects
